Having personally experienced the Caudalie Spa facial in Toronto, I can attest to the benefits of a treatment that focuses on customization to individual skin needs. As someone with dry, sensitive, and acne-prone skin, finding a facial that balances effective cleansing without irritation is key. The spa's approach—carefully selecting products and techniques based on my skin condition—resulted in gentle exfoliation and the effective removal of blackheads, especially on the nose, which often harbors congestion. What stood out was the use of cold therapy post-extraction. This technique helps calm the skin, reducing redness and minimizing pores, while the infusion of hydration revitalized my complexion immediately. The overall experience included a soothing facial massage, enhancing relaxation and promoting circulation — crucial for skin repair and a healthy glow. For those transitioning off Accutane or with compromised skin barriers, waiting the recommended six months before facials ensures safety and effectiveness. This facial was not just about aesthetics; it felt like a restorative ritual that encouraged my skin to heal and glow naturally. The results were noticeable—a radiant complexion that looked nourished and refreshed.
